Why is professional duct cleaning important for my HVAC system in Johnson City?

Over time, dust, pollen, pet dander, mold spores, and construction debris accumulate inside your ductwork. Johnson City’s humid summers and variable winters can accelerate microbial growth, forcing your HVAC system to work harder and circulating contaminants throughout your home. A thorough duct cleaning removes this buildup, helping your system operate more efficiently, lowering energy bills, extending equipment life, and improving indoor air quality for allergy and asthma sufferers.

How often should I schedule air duct cleaning?

Most homes benefit from duct cleaning every 3–5 years. However, you may need it more frequently if you have pets that shed heavily, household members with respiratory issues, recent remodeling projects, water damage, or if you notice visible dust blowing from vents. New homeowners should also consider a cleaning to remove debris left by previous occupants. What signs indicate that my air ducts need cleaning?

Common red flags include: 1) visible dust puffs or black streaks around supply registers; 2) a musty or stale odor when the HVAC turns on; 3) unexplained respiratory irritation or allergy flare-ups; 4) inconsistent airflow between rooms; 5) an unusual spike in energy bills; and 6) evidence of rodents, insects, or mold in or around ductwork. If you experience any of these issues, scheduling a professional inspection is the safest way to determine whether duct cleaning is warranted.

What happens during a professional duct cleaning service visit?

Our certified technicians arrive with negative-pressure vacuum equipment, rotary brushes, and HEPA filtration. 1) We begin with a camera inspection to document the condition of the ducts. 2) Supply and return registers are sealed to create a closed loop. 3) The vacuum is connected to the main trunk line, drawing contaminants out while rotary brushes dislodge stubborn deposits. 4) We sanitize ducts with an EPA-registered solution if microbial growth is present. 5) Finally, we reinstall cleaned registers, replace filters, and provide before-and-after photos along with maintenance tips. Most single-family homes take 2–4 hours.

Will duct cleaning improve indoor air quality and energy efficiency?

Yes. Removing accumulated debris eliminates a reservoir of airborne pollutants, reducing the number of particles circulating through your living space. This is especially beneficial in Johnson City, where pollen and humidity can aggravate allergies. Cleaner ducts allow conditioned air to flow freely, meaning your HVAC system doesn’t have to run as long or as hard to achieve the desired temperature, typically yielding energy savings of 5–15% and decreasing wear on blowers, coils, and motors.

How much does duct cleaning cost in Johnson City, and what factors affect price?

For a typical 2,000-square-foot home in the Johnson City area, comprehensive duct cleaning usually ranges from $350 to $600. Pricing varies based on the number of supply and return vents, the length and accessibility of duct runs, the presence of flexible versus rigid metal ducts, and whether additional services—such as antimicrobial treatment, dryer vent cleaning, or coil cleaning—are requested at the same visit.
